The Club Room

Located In: Ocean Prime - Indianapolis

Seated: 8

Ocean Prime - Indianapolis

Ocean Prime - Indianapolis

The Club Room
Address
Ocean Prime - Indianapolis

8555 River Road Indianapolis, IN 46240

Business Space Location Map
Capacity

Seated: 8

Square Feet: 155 ft2

F&B Options
In-house catering
Frequent Uses
  • Private Dining